Paver Flooring Installation in Davis County, UT
Paver flooring installation involves the placement of durable, decorative paving stones to create functional and attractive surfaces for outdoor spaces. This service is commonly used for patios, walkways, driveways, and pool decks, offering a versatile option that enhances curb appeal and property value. Property owners typically want to understand the variety of paver materials available, such as concrete, brick, or natural stone, as well as the overall process involved in preparing the site, laying the pavers, and ensuring proper drainage and stability.
Before requesting paver flooring installation, homeowners often seek information about the scope of the project, including design options, color choices, and layout patterns. It’s also helpful to consider the existing landscape and any necessary site preparation, such as grading or base work, to ensure a long-lasting result. Clarifying expectations about maintenance and durability can aid in selecting the best materials and installation methods to meet specific needs and preferences.

Common Paver Flooring Installation Jobs
Paver Driveways - durable surfaces designed to enhance curb appeal and withstand heavy traffic.
Paver Patios - versatile outdoor spaces that add functionality and aesthetic value to backyard areas.
Paver Walkways - safe and attractive paths connecting different areas of a property.
Paver Pool Decks - slip-resistant surfaces that surround pools for safety and style.
Paver Garden Borders - defined edges that add structure and visual interest to landscaping.
Paver Courtyards - elegant outdoor gathering spaces built for durability and visual appeal.
Paver Flooring Installation Questions
What are common uses for paver flooring? Paver flooring is often used for patios, walkways, driveways, and outdoor seating areas to create durable and attractive surfaces.
What materials are typically used for paver flooring? Common materials include concrete, brick, and natural stone, each offering different styles and durability levels.
How does paver installation impact outdoor property appearance? Properly installed pavers can enhance curb appeal by providing a neat, uniform, and aesthetically pleasing surface.
What should property owners consider before choosing paver flooring? Consider the intended use, style preferences, and the existing landscape to select the right type of paver for the space.
